Publication Account (1995)

A smart residence built for George Heggie in 1786. It is haded with ashlar belt courses, with centre bows at front and back, the front one being carried on a Roman doric portico.

Information from ‘Historic Kirkcaldy: The Archaeological Implications of Development’ (1995).
